Austin Fire Department Embraces High-Tech Mapping to Combat Wildfire Threat

As Austin faces increasing wildfire risks, the Austin Fire Department (AFD) is turning to cutting-edge GIS mapping technology to stay ahead of the flames. By analyzing vegetation, terrain, and weather conditions, this high-tech approach helps firefighters pinpoint vulnerable areas, plan rapid responses, and improve evacuation strategies. Austin’s Cold Weather Shelters Open as Temperatures Drop—How You Can Help

As temperatures drop below freezing, Austin’s cold weather shelters are opening their doors to provide warmth, meals, and essential resources for those in need. While most homeowners prepare their houses for the chill, not everyone has a safe place to stay. These shelters offer a lifeline during extreme weather, and the community can help by donating, volunteering, or spreading awareness.
